Munich, Germany – A Vietnam Airlines aircraft recently avoided what aviation experts are calling a potential catastrophe at Munich Airport when its tail struck the runway during a delayed takeoff, an incident attributed to multiple pilot errors. The event has prompted serious questions about flight safety protocols and crew training within the aviation industry.

Reports indicate the incident occurred after a noticeable delay in the aircrafts departure sequence. As the plane accelerated down the runway, its rotation for takeoff was apparently executed late, causing the tail section to scrape against the tarmac with considerable force.

Aviation expert Peter Gatz emphasized the gravity of the situation, stating, "The two pilots certainly made several mistakes here." He further elaborated on the potential scenarios that could have unfolded, all of which, he stressed, "must not occur" in professional aviation.

A tail strike, as defined by aviation safety bodies, is a critical event where the rear fuselage of an aircraft contacts the runway during takeoff or landing. While often visually subtle from a distance, it can inflict severe structural damage to the airframe.

The immediate consequence of a tail strike can include damage to the aircrafts pressure hull. Undetected or inadequately repaired, such damage poses a serious risk of fuselage fatigue, depressurization at altitude, or even catastrophic structural failure during subsequent flights.

Investigators will undoubtedly focus on the precise sequence of events leading to the delayed rotation. Factors typically examined include pilot technique, the aircrafts weight and balance, runway conditions, and adherence to standard operating procedures.

Delayed takeoffs can sometimes lead to rushed decision-making or deviations from optimal flight parameters. Pilots are trained to maintain precise control over pitch during rotation to avoid both tail strikes and nose-high stalls.

Peter Gatzs assessment underscores the fundamental importance of pilot judgment and adherence to established checklists and flight envelope limits. Even minor deviations can accumulate into hazardous situations, especially during critical phases of flight like takeoff.

While specific details regarding the immediate aftermath of the Vietnam Airlines incident remain under investigation, standard procedures would involve a thorough inspection of the aircraft. Any damage discovered would necessitate extensive repairs before the aircraft is cleared for service again.
